Construct a Budget That Reflects Your Life
A spending plan is not one-size-fits-all. It's individual. It must reflect not just your revenue and costs, yet your values, your lifestyle, and your objectives. Some individuals fit with spreadsheets; others like budgeting apps or perhaps the old envelope system. Choose a technique that matches your habits-- not somebody else's.
If you're simply starting, a simple 50/30/20 regulation can help:
- 50% of your revenue goes toward requirements
- 30% towards wants
- 20% toward financial savings or debt benefit
But that's only a beginning factor. Some months will be leaner, others a lot more adaptable. Your budget must advance with your life.
And don't neglect to pay on your own first. Even a little month-to-month contribution to your personal savings account constructs momentum. Gradually, it becomes a routine, not a hurdle.

Credit Scores Isn't the Enemy-- It's a Tool
Credit score obtains a bad rap. But used wisely, it can be among your most effective tools for building economic toughness. From financing major acquisitions to leveraging lending institution charge card for benefits and convenience, credit scores offers adaptability-- if you appreciate its power.
Stay disciplined. Establish notifies to remind you of repayment due dates. Maintain your usage reduced-- ideally under 30% of your complete readily available debt. And prevent making an application for numerous lines of credit in a brief time period. Liable credit score use opens doors-- actually, if you're looking at home mortgages.
